Simba (VA)'s Story
Meet Simba, an affectionate 4-year-old boy who weighs around 15 lbs. Simba is a well-mannered young boy: he's house-trained, sleeps quietly in his crate at night, and uses the dog door like a pro in his foster home. Simba loves wrestling with his canine foster sister and taking long walks, but he is equally happy curling up under a blanket. He's a true homebody and cuddlebug whose preferred activity is napping. He's a good car rider and is still working on his leash-walking manners. When Simba came into foster care, he had a terrible case of mange. He has since completely healed with his fur starting to grow back in.
